I have added a suggestion for a third agenda item "Discussion on content for Call for Proposals for FOSS4G 2022”

The Board will need to reach a conclusion by end August on how it wishes to proceed with FOSS4G 2022 if we are going to prepare a call for proposals and get through the process by the end of the year (assuming something similar to the 2 stage process of past years)
